Output 74bcd1937dd66b51a5a7d3355fce1ec911441b1ca4a7a7afd0ce29d92bb13e3a:0

value
152700
script pubkey
OP_0 OP_PUSHBYTES_20 d5815cec0c0af5571e8f7f9b500a9dc8b76ab9e6
address
bc1q6kq4emqvpt64w85007d4qz5aezmk4w0xfhxhvg
transaction
74bcd1937dd66b51a5a7d3355fce1ec911441b1ca4a7a7afd0ce29d92bb13e3a
confirmations
163786
spent
true